Condividi tramite


ServiceLifetime Enumerazione

Definizione

Specifica la durata di un servizio in IServiceCollection.

public enum class ServiceLifetime
public enum ServiceLifetime
type ServiceLifetime = 
Public Enum ServiceLifetime
Ereditarietà
ServiceLifetime

Campi

Scoped 1

Specifica che verrà creata una nuova istanza del servizio per ogni ambito. Nelle app ASP.NET Core viene creato un ambito intorno a ogni richiesta del server.

Singleton 0

Specifica che verrà creata una singola istanza del servizio.

Transient 2

Specifica che verrà creata una nuova istanza del servizio ogni volta che è necessario.

Si applica a